PATHOLOGY & ONCOLOGY RESEARCH

This Unit incorporates cancer research and laboratory diagnostics to enhance cancer screening and early diagnosis.

Its main focus is in application of laboratory sciences in cancer research and spearhead research and clinical trials in cancer therapies.

  1. Develop and test early screening and diagnostic tools for cancer control.
  2. Evaluate and assess tissues for cancer and provide pathological profiles for diagnosis and staging.
  3. Spearhead cancer immunology and genetics research.
  4. Provide a platform for cancer diagnosis and act as referral for other centres.
  5. Engage in capacity building for pathology in cancer diagnosis and treatment.
  6. Conduct clinical trials in cancer.
  7. Through multidisciplinary engagement participate in development of solutions for cancer control including risk factor and epidemiological studies.
